Been using the xt snag leader for a while now can’t recommend it enough it’s more supple than Korda boom but stiffer than a semi stiff coated braid, for me i think it’s perfect. I have straighten a size 4 hook pulling for a break from an underwater snag. I have also used it as a leader when using braided mainline to protect the fish it’s great for that too. I tried trick link I hated that stuff it knotted terrible. I was skeptical about crimping it after I got told you could also crimp trick link and it was far weaker than a figure of 8 knot but with the Korda .6 crimps I cannot break the xt snag leader pulling with 2 pulla tools.

I have used korda 50lb xt snag leader for my booms on Ronnie's, hinges and combi multi rigs, a reel lasts for ages and its really good stuff. You can crimp it if you want to and never had any issues.

I saw Tom stokes use it and never looked back.

If you are after a like for like product there is OMC Kickback but that is only £1 cheaper or there is Terminal Tackle UK Reset which is £5 for 10m.
